English sycamore is a member of the maple family and is found throughout Europe. This is the lumber that is used for violins, cellos, basses, and violas. It is often quartered which of course is required for musical instruments. English sycamore is used extensively for architectural millwork when designers want a very white colored lumber and can be highly figured with a curl or what the British like to call ripple. *Often found with curl figure (ripple) *Larger logs usually quartered *Highly prized for veneers *Superior tonewood for classical instruments *Good substitute were thicker / wide white material is needed
